Population Overview

Burgettstown borough is a small community located in Pennsylvania, within Washington County. The total population is 1,376. It ranks as the 835th most populous out of 1,993 cities and towns in Pennsylvania.

Age Demographics

The median age in Burgettstown borough is 47.7 years. This is 17% higher than the state median of 40.9 years. 11.4% of residents are 75 or older, suggesting a significant retirement-age population with implications for healthcare services and senior housing.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Burgettstown borough is $58,000. This is 24% lower than the state median of $76,081.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 26% lower. The poverty rate stands at 8.2%. This is 30% lower than the state poverty rate of 11.8%. The unemployment rate is 6.2%. This is 18% higher than the state rate of 5.3%. The median home value is $140,800. Housing costs are 41% lower than the state median of $240,500.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 2.4x, Burgettstown borough is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 59.1%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 15% lower than the state average of 69.3%.

Race & Ethnicity

Burgettstown borough has a predominantly White (non-Hispanic) population, comprising 91.8% of all residents.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 2.5%. The Black or African American population (1.7%) is well below the state average of 10.3%. The Hispanic or Latino population (2.5%) is well below the state average of 8.4%.

Education

20.3%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 41% lower than the state rate of 34.5%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 89.0%.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Burgettstown borough, Pennsylvania is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ates (2019-2023). The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ually, providing reliable estimates for communities of all sizes. Comparisons are made against Pennsylvania state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 1,993 Census-designated places in Pennsylvania. For official data, visit data.census.gov.
